Output 57584130b1f1e9894b673eb0063ce1ef02a99f29997ac6fd69eb247398a8cd66:7

value
55310399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a81513eba56ecc6691e561ffb4c0b329a1e4356 OP_EQUAL
address
3QXZmdTBFFbwCKATRkbaLtchbX4tgFUaWi
transaction
57584130b1f1e9894b673eb0063ce1ef02a99f29997ac6fd69eb247398a8cd66
spent
true